AWK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

713 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in American Water Works (AWK)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$13.1B — up 5.5% from $12.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 76 funds opened new AWK positions and 54 closed out — a net gain of 22 holders — while 242 added to existing stakes and 241 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Deutsche Bank, adding an estimated $92.5M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$116M.
